The Grand Rapids Project was commissioned by Jack Hoedeman with the idea of capturing the history, and present-day spirit of the people and the city, as well as the state of Michigan. The Mural is made up of photos taken by the artist in and around the city and then assembled as a montage. The Mural is constructed of 9 plexiglass panels each measuring 40″ x 40″ which are suspended from a wall. Total Mural size is approximately 12′ x12′.

The Mural is installed @ Compass Insurance, 280 Ann St NW., Grand Rapids, MI
